smother
Nouns
- (n) a confused multitude of things clutter, fuddle, jumble, mare's nest, muddle, welter,
- (n) a stifling cloud of smoke
Verbs
-
(v) envelop completely
- smother the meat in gravy
-
(v) deprive of oxygen and prevent from breathing
- Othello smothered Desdemona with a pillow
- The child suffocated herself with a plastic bag that the parents had left on the floor
-
(v) conceal or hide
- smother a yawn
- muffle one's anger
- strangle a yawn
-
(v) form an impenetrable cover over
- the butter cream smothered the cake
-
(v) deprive of the oxygen necessary for combustion
- smother fires
